Richard Smith - "I am a ceramic artist exploring the methodology and aesthetic of wood and soda fired ceramics. The minerals in the clay react to the fire, and while it is possible to control, to a degree, how ash or soda, and flame, flow through the kiln and settle to melt on the ceramic surface, I am not looking for predictability. My goal is to create forms that are aesthetically enjoyable, with surface minerals sublimely enhancing the work. My celadon glazed piece, Flask, is a vessel that could contain a flower, or your favorite single malt whiskey."
